Quincy Community Theatre's 2022 season is off and running, tickets are on sale now for their upcoming youth musical "You're a Good Man Charlie Brown" and if you are someone in the Quincy/Hannibal 18 or older your chance to be on stage is coming up with auditions for the classic American musical "MAME" one of the funniest shows ever written.

Auditions are on Monday and Tuesday, February 7th and 8th, and Quincy Community Theatre is looking for actors, singers, and dancers of all shapes, sizes, ethnicities, and ages from 18 and up to sign up for an audition slot. "When young Patrick is plucked from his rural upbringing in Iowa to live with his wildly enthusiastic New York socialite Auntie Mame, he swiftly learns that “Life is a banquet, and most poor suckers are starving to death!” Mame’s captivating optimism and zest for life endear her to (almost) everyone she crosses paths with. Packed with musical theatre classics, such as “It’s Today” and “We Need a Little Christmas,” Mame will leave you feeling exhilarated and full of hope!"
